Kansas HB2013 eliminates sales tax on cable, community antennae, and television services.
Kansas HB2013 amends the state sales tax law to remove the tax on cable, community antennae, and television services. This bill modifies the existing tax code to exclude these services from the taxable gross receipts, effective from the date of publication. The changes aim to provide relief to consumers by eliminating the sales tax burden on these essential communication services.
